Nel vasto universo del web, dove l’informazione si snoda e si trasforma in un⁣ battito⁤ d’ali virtuale, i linguaggi di markup si‌ ergono come i ⁤pilastri invisibili che ⁢sostengono e definiscono la struttura di ‍ciò che⁢ vediamo. Dall’alba di HTML, il linguaggio che ⁢ha concesso forma e sostanza alle prime pagine web,⁣ fino alle⁢ più moderne e sofisticate⁣ varianti come XML e Markdown, l’evoluzione di ⁢questi ⁣strumenti non è soltanto un mero passaggio tecnico, ⁣ma un ⁤viaggio che⁢ riflette le⁢ necessità ‌e le ‍sfide​ di un ‌mondo in continua metamorfosi. Attraverso ⁢le⁤ pagine ‍di questo articolo, esploreremo insieme le‍ tappe‍ fondamentali ‌di questa trasformazione, analizzando non⁤ solo ⁣l’aspetto tecnico,‌ ma ⁢anche l’impatto culturale⁢ e ‍sociale che i linguaggi di markup​ hanno⁣ avuto sulla nostra ​vita digitale. Scopriamo dunque⁤ come questi ​codici, apparentemente semplici, hanno plasmato il nostro‌ modo‍ di ​comunicare e interagire nel vasto mare dell’informazione online.

Il⁢ viaggio⁢ dei linguaggi di markup: dalle origini ad oggi

Nel vasto universo del web, i ⁢linguaggi ⁢di markup hanno ⁣tracciato ‌un‌ percorso straordinario, ‌evolvendosi e ⁢adattandosi alle esigenze di sviluppatori e utenti. Fin dagli ​albori di Internet, i linguaggi di​ markup hanno rappresentato ⁤la ⁣spina ⁤dorsale della creazione ​di contenuti, ⁣fornendo strumenti⁢ per strutturare,​ presentare e gestire le​ informazioni.per comprendere questo viaggio, è fondamentale risalire alle ⁢origini,⁣ quando il primo linguaggio di‌ markup,‍ l’HTML (Hypertext ⁤Markup Language),‍ ha​ fatto la⁢ sua comparsa.

L’HTML è stato ‌sviluppato da Tim​ Berners-Lee ​nei primi anni ’90⁢ come parte‍ di una ‌visione‌ più ampia ​di un⁤ sistema ​di informazioni ipertestuale. Con‍ la capacità ⁤di collegare documenti⁢ e di ‍presentare testi in ​modo formattato, questo linguaggio ha​ rivoluzionato il modo ‍in cui navigavamo le informazioni. I documenti non erano più solo pagine statiche, ma entità dinamiche ⁤che potevano interagire con​ l’utente. ‌Con l’HTML, i ⁣contenuti hanno ‌preso ⁣forma ‌visibile, creando un ambiente dove l’interazione e la fruizione sono‍ diventate⁢ prioritarie.

Negli‌ anni successivi,⁢ la crescita esplosiva del web ha ⁣reso evidente la‌ necessità di​ ulteriori evoluzioni.​ La⁤ nascita di CSS (Cascading Style ‌Sheets) ha segnato‌ un momento chiave nel panorama dei ⁤linguaggi di markup. ‍Con CSS, gli sviluppatori hanno ‌potuto separare il contenuto dalla presentazione,⁣ consentendo una maggiore flessibilità nella creazione di‍ layout⁢ e stili visivi. Grazie all’introduzione di regole⁢ di stile, è diventato possibile decorare in⁤ modo sofisticato ⁢le pagine web, migliorando l’esperienza ‌utente senza compromettere ‍la struttura del documento HTML.

Con l’emergere delle tecnologie web,‍ sono ⁢nati‌ nuovi linguaggi di markup, come XML ⁣(eXtensible Markup language),⁢ concepito per‍ facilitare lo ​scambio di dati tra sistemi ‍diversi. XML consente di definire⁤ le proprie etichette, rendendolo un linguaggio versatile e robusto per molte‌ applicazioni.⁢ È stato‌ utilizzato⁤ in vari​ settori,dal publishing al ⁤gaming,dimostrando il suo​ valore nella gestione dei dati.L’adozione di ​XML ha aperto la ⁤strada a standard come‍ JSON (JavaScript Object Notation), ‌che​ continua a dominare nel panorama della⁤ trasmissione di dati.

In parallelo, ‌la crescente complessità delle ​applicazioni web ha ⁢portato alla​ nascita di linguaggi ‌di markup ‍più specializzati. Con ​l’arrivo di framework come ⁤React e Angular,il concetto di markup⁤ ha ⁤subito⁢ un’evoluzione,integrando logica ⁢e presentazione​ in modi prima impensabili. ​Questi nuovi‍ paradigmi hanno permesso agli ⁤sviluppatori di creare‍ interfacce⁢ utente altamente reattive, rivoluzionando il ⁢modo ⁤in‍ cui interagiamo con i siti‍ web.​ L’uso di JSX, ad esempio, ha consentito di scrivere markup ‌simile all’HTML ​all’interno di‌ codice JavaScript, unificando ​logica e struttura in un unico flusso di lavoro.

La ⁣transizione ‌verso il⁣ mobile ha ulteriormente influenzato l’evoluzione dei⁤ linguaggi di markup. Con ⁢l’aumento ‍esponenziale dell’uso ‌di smartphone⁢ e ‍tablet, ​è diventato⁢ cruciale⁣ ottimizzare i contenuti per​ una varietà di dispositivi. ciò ha portato all’adozione di pratiche di design ‌responsive, dove⁤ il markup adattabile diventa fondamentale.L’HTML5, con la⁢ sua gamma estesa di nuove ‍funzionalità e‌ tag semantici, ha facilitato questa‍ transizione, migliorando non ‍solo l’estetica ma anche l’accessibilità e la SEO.

Un‍ aspetto ⁣significativo da considerare‌ è l’importanza‍ della semantica nel markup⁣ moderno. oggi,gli sviluppatori‌ sono sempre più consapevoli‍ di come una corretta struttura del contenuto possa influenzare non solo‍ l’usabilità ma anche ⁣il posizionamento sui ‍motori‍ di ​ricerca. Utilizzare⁤ tag appropriati, come `

`, `

` e⁣ `

`,‌ permette di ⁤comunicare ⁣chiaramente ai motori di ricerca quali parti ‍di una ‍pagina‌ contengano⁤ contenuti importanti. ‌Questo approccio semantico non solo migliora ​l’accessibilità per gli utenti con disabilità, ma⁣ contribuisce ‍anche a⁣ una migliore indicizzazione da parte dei motori di ricerca.

Guardando⁢ al futuro,‌ è evidente ‍che⁣ i⁣ linguaggi ⁤di markup ‍continueranno a ⁢evolversi in risposta⁢ alle⁤ nuove tecnologie e⁤ alle‍ esigenze degli utenti.L’integrazione‍ di intelligenza artificiale ‌e‌ machine ⁢learning nel ‌web design potrebbe condurre a ⁣linguaggi di markup più avanzati, ⁤capaci di adattarsi‌ in ​tempo reale ⁢alle preferenze degli utenti. La‌ direzione in cui ⁢si‍ muove ​il settore è affascinante e piena ​di opportunità, con chiari segnali‍ che l’innovazione rimarrà al centro della creazione web.

il viaggio dei linguaggi‍ di ‌markup riflette‌ non solo l’evoluzione tecnologica del web, ma anche il cambiamento ‍delle ⁣aspettative⁢ degli⁤ utenti.​ Da‍ HTML a linguaggi ‍più ⁢sofisticati e⁣ semantici,‌ il percorso è costellato​ di traguardi fondamentali che hanno plasmato la‌ nostra ⁢interazione con online. Man mano che​ entriamo in una nuova⁤ era del ‌digitale,l’importanza di ⁢un markup ben strutturato ⁤e accessibile ⁤rimarrà un imperativo⁢ per tutti gli sviluppatori ‌del futuro.